A £1 million competition opened on 13 May to find solutions that can transform the rail customer’s experience.

The GB rail industry is seeking innovative solutions which will lead to transformation of the rail customer’s experience, both passengers and freight customers.

The Enabling Innovation Team (EIT) is running a £1 million prize-bearing competition for those innovative ideas with the most significant impact for customers.

In addition to solutions from the existing rail supply chain, proposals are sought from non-rail sectors, including transferring best practice technologies, processes and business models from sectors who have successfully transformed their own customers’ experience.

The competition launched on 13 May 2013 – together with details of proposal criteria and guidelines, and will remain open for a period of 2 months. Proposals will then be judged, feedback provided and finalists invited to a final award presentation event (September 2013).
